Transaction 0576e3a6ebec68bd002a070b90fb8f4bf5ef3699c610ff2531941bce2aa37d4a
1 Input
1 Output
-
0576e3a6ebec68bd002a070b90fb8f4bf5ef3699c610ff2531941bce2aa37d4a:0
- value
- 70285
- script pubkey
- OP_0 OP_PUSHBYTES_20 cebbc801db01ea2f58d7fd34792baad3915cbc8c
- address
- bc1qe6ausqwmq84z7kxhl568j2a26wg4e0yvwsvkmf